A paradox is in contrary to expectations. It may also refer to perceived opinion or existing belief. It is a statement which includes ultimate truth but is self-contradictory. To make the reader think in an innovative way, a paradox is used.
Few examples of paradox are:
“I can resist anything but temptation.” – Oscar Wilde
Therefore, best definition of paradox is the pairing of opposites.
